The Linx WordPress theme is a stylish, minimalist, and high-performance choice designed specifically for content-heavy sites like lifestyle blogs, online magazines, and travel journals.
Unlike many "bloated" magazine themes that rely on heavy page builders, Linx focuses on a clean, grid-based aesthetic and speed.
Modern Grid Layouts: It offers multiple ways to display your posts, including masonry grids, classic lists, and "magazine-style" content blocks.
Fully Responsive: It is built with a mobile-first approach, ensuring the typography remains legible and the images scale perfectly on small screens.
Easy Customization: Everything is handled through the WordPress Live Customizer, allowing you to see changes to colors, fonts, and layouts in real-time without refreshing the page.
Optimized for Readability: The theme places a heavy emphasis on white space and clean typography, making it ideal for long-form articles.
One-Click Demo Import: It includes several pre-built "niches" (Food, Travel, Fashion) that you can import instantly to get your site looking like the preview version.
Multiple Header Styles: Choose from various navigation layouts, including "sticky" headers that stay at the top as readers scroll.
Instagram Integration: Built-in widgets allow you to showcase your Instagram feed in the footer or sidebar, which is essential for lifestyle influencers.
Post Formats: Native support for video, audio, gallery, and quote post formats, allowing for a diverse content mix.
Performance Focused: The theme is coded with best practices for SEO and page speed, helping you rank better on Google.
Gutenberg Ready: Linx works beautifully with the WordPress Block Editor (Gutenberg). You can use "Query Loops" to create custom magazine layouts directly within the editor.
Child Theme: Always activate the provided child theme before you start customizing. This ensures your changes aren't lost when the developer releases a security or feature update.
Image Optimization: Because magazine themes are image-heavy, I recommend using a plugin like ShortPixel or Imagify alongside Linx to keep your loading speeds lightning-fast.
